The invention discloses a method and device for predicting the straight lane changing intention of a vehicle and a computer storage medium. The method for predicting the straight lane changing intention of the vehicle comprises the steps that a first driving parameter of the vehicle is obtained, and a second driving parameter of a target vehicle is obtained; obtaining lane line parameters of a current lane where the vehicle is located; according to the lane line parameters, whether the current lane where the vehicle runs is a straight lane or not is judged; and if yes, determining the lane changing intention of the target vehicle through a preset lane changing judgment condition according to the first driving parameter or the second driving parameter. By adopting the method, the lane changing intention of the target vehicle can be quickly predicted when the vehicle travels on the straight road, so that information can be conveniently provided for track planning of the vehicle subsequently, and collision between the vehicle and the target vehicle is avoided.
